Paul McGrath's Stephen Kenny comments divide opinion

Republic of Ireland fans are divided on Paul McGrath's recents comments about Stephen Kenny.

The fomer defender stated that he does not believe Kenny is the man to lead Ireland forward and said change is needed.

He told RTE 2fm's Game On: "When I watched the Portugal and Serbia games, the football that the lads played, in midfield and playing out from the back, they really are good players, but I have to say, it’s my belief that Stephen might not be the person to take us on to that level where we are starting to win things again.

"I like Stephen, I love what he done with Dundalk, but there is something about Stephen in his way with the team at the moment, I don’t think he is going to change just because we are losing or drawing most games.

"I think we do need to change. If we are losing games, we need to go to something else to try and win."

Some fans agreed with McGrath's opinion, while others strongly disagreed, but one thing that many fans did agree on was that it could be difficult to find someone to replace Kenny.

One person said: "McGrath is right. Football is a results business not this ''future'' guff. Having said that who would take the job?"

But someone else commented: "He is doing the best the can with players he has to pick from. The Irish team and management need support now more than when they are winning."

Another post read: "He is doing the best he can with what he has.....there won't be a queue for the job."

Someone else tweeted: "Disappointed in Paul McGrath here. Not fair to Stephen Kenny in my opinion. Let him get on with the job and stop bringing out ex-footballers, who never managed to blast him!"

One other person simply wrote in response to McGrath's comments: "Dead right."
